Say Goodbye to Tinnitus: Effective Strategies for Finding Relief

Finding relief from tinnitus can be a journey, but with the right strategies in place, you can significantly reduce the ringing in your ears. One effective method is sound therapy, which involves listening to white noise or soothing sounds to mask the tinnitus. This can help distract your brain from focusing on the ringing and provide temporary relief. Additionally, cognitive behavioral therapy (CBT) can help you reframe your thoughts and emotions surrounding tinnitus, allowing you to better cope with the symptoms.

Another powerful tool for minimising tinnitus is maintaining a strong support system. Talking to friends, family, or a therapist about your tinnitus can help you feel less isolated and more understood. Furthermore, incorporating stress-reducing activities like yoga or tai chi into your routine can help calm your nervous system and reduce the intensity of tinnitus.
